Mercurial > 510Connectbot
comparison proguard.cfg @ 0:0ce5cc452d02
initial version
author | Carl Byington <carl@five-ten-sg.com> |
---|---|
date | Thu, 22 May 2014 10:41:19 -0700 |
parents | |
children |
comparison
equal
deleted
inserted
replaced
-1:000000000000 | 0:0ce5cc452d02 |
---|---|
1 #-keepattributes SourceFile,LineNumberTable | |
2 #-optimizationpasses 5 | |
3 -dontobfuscate | |
4 -dontoptimize | |
5 -dontusemixedcaseclassnames | |
6 -dontskipnonpubliclibraryclasses | |
7 -dontpreverify | |
8 -verbose | |
9 -optimizations !code/simplification/arithmetic,!field/*,!class/merging/* | |
10 | |
11 -keep public class * extends android.app.Activity | |
12 -keep public class * extends android.app.Application | |
13 -keep public class * extends android.app.Service | |
14 -keep public class * extends android.content.BroadcastReceiver | |
15 -keep public class * extends android.content.ContentProvider | |
16 -keep public class * extends android.app.backup.BackupAgentHelper | |
17 -keep public class * extends android.preference.Preference | |
18 | |
19 -keepclasseswithmembernames class * { | |
20 native <methods>; | |
21 } | |
22 | |
23 -keepclasseswithmembers class * { | |
24 public <init>(android.content.Context, android.util.AttributeSet); | |
25 } | |
26 | |
27 -keepclasseswithmembers class * { | |
28 public <init>(android.content.Context, android.util.AttributeSet, int); | |
29 } | |
30 | |
31 -keepclassmembers class * extends android.app.Activity { | |
32 public void *(android.view.View); | |
33 } | |
34 | |
35 -keepclassmembers enum * { | |
36 public static **[] values(); | |
37 public static ** valueOf(java.lang.String); | |
38 } | |
39 | |
40 -keep class * implements android.os.Parcelable { | |
41 public static final android.os.Parcelable$Creator *; | |
42 } | |
43 | |
44 -keep class org.connectbot.** | |
45 -keep public class com.trilead.ssh2.compression.* | |
46 -keep public class com.trilead.ssh2.crypto.* |